.Hero-module-scss-module__wWWu7W__radar_wrapper{z-index:0;pointer-events:none;width:1400px;height:700px;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);-webkit-mask-image:linear-gradient(#000 60%,#0000 100%);mask-image:linear-gradient(#000 60%,#0000 100%)}@media not (min-width:768px){.Hero-module-scss-module__wWWu7W__radar_wrapper{width:800px;height:500px}}.Hero-module-scss-module__wWWu7W__marquee_wrapper{-webkit-mask-image:linear-gradient(90deg,#0000,#000 10% 90%,#0000);mask-image:linear-gradient(90deg,#0000,#000 10% 90%,#0000)}.Hero-module-scss-module__wWWu7W__marquee_wrapper:hover .Hero-module-scss-module__wWWu7W__marquee_track{animation-play-state:paused!important}@keyframes Hero-module-scss-module__wWWu7W__infinite-scroll{0%{transform:translate(0)}to{transform:translate(calc(-100% - .75rem))}}.Hero-module-scss-module__wWWu7W__marquee_track{animation:80s linear infinite Hero-module-scss-module__wWWu7W__infinite-scroll}@media (max-width:768px){.Hero-module-scss-module__wWWu7W__marquee_track{animation-duration:140s}}.Hero-module-scss-module__wWWu7W__radar_dome{border-bottom:none;border-top-left-radius:700px;border-top-right-radius:700px;width:100%;height:100%;position:relative;overflow:hidden}.Hero-module-scss-module__wWWu7W__ring{opacity:.8;border:2px dashed color-mix(in srgb, var(--foreground) 15%, transparent);border-bottom:none;border-top-left-radius:700px;border-top-right-radius:700px;position:absolute;bottom:0;left:50%;transform:translate(-50%)}.Hero-module-scss-module__wWWu7W__ring_1{width:400px;height:200px}@media not (min-width:768px){.Hero-module-scss-module__wWWu7W__ring_1{width:300px;height:200px}}.Hero-module-scss-module__wWWu7W__ring_2{width:800px;height:400px}@media not (min-width:768px){.Hero-module-scss-module__wWWu7W__ring_2{width:500px;height:300px}}.Hero-module-scss-module__wWWu7W__ring_3{width:1200px;height:600px}@media not (min-width:768px){.Hero-module-scss-module__wWWu7W__ring_3{width:800px;height:400px}}.Hero-module-scss-module__wWWu7W__scanner_beam{transform-origin:50% 100%;opacity:.7;background:conic-gradient(from 270deg at 50% 100%, transparent 0deg, color-mix(in srgb, var(--gold,#fcc11b) 2%, transparent) 40deg, color-mix(in srgb, var(--gold,#fcc11b) 35%, transparent) 90deg, transparent 91deg);will-change:transform;width:1400px;height:1400px;animation:8s linear infinite Hero-module-scss-module__wWWu7W__sweep;position:absolute;bottom:0;left:50%;transform:translate(-50%)translateZ(0)}@media not (min-width:768px){.Hero-module-scss-module__wWWu7W__scanner_beam{animation:none;display:none}}.Hero-module-scss-module__wWWu7W__radar_icon{transform-origin:50% 100%;pointer-events:auto;cursor:pointer;z-index:50;position:absolute;bottom:0;left:50%}.Hero-module-scss-module__wWWu7W__radar_box{background-color:color-mix(in srgb, var(--card) 60%, transparent);-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);border:1px solid var(--border);width:56px;height:56px;box-shadow:0 10px 25px color-mix(in srgb, var(--foreground) 15%, transparent);opacity:.7;will-change:transform,opacity,box-shadow;border-radius:1rem;justify-content:center;align-items:center;transition:transform .3s;animation:8s linear infinite Hero-module-scss-module__wWWu7W__radar_ping;display:flex;transform:translateZ(0)}@media not (min-width:768px){.Hero-module-scss-module__wWWu7W__radar_box{-webkit-backdrop-filter:none;backdrop-filter:none;width:40px;height:40px;box-shadow:0 8px 18px color-mix(in srgb, var(--foreground) 10%, transparent);border-color:var(--border);animation:none}}.Hero-module-scss-module__wWWu7W__radar_icon:hover .Hero-module-scss-module__wWWu7W__radar_box{border-color:color-mix(in srgb, var(--gold,#fcc11b) 60%, transparent);box-shadow:0 0 30px color-mix(in srgb, var(--gold,#fcc11b) 30%, transparent);background-color:var(--card);animation-play-state:paused;transform:scale(1.25)translateY(-8px)}.Hero-module-scss-module__wWWu7W__icon_pos_1{transform:translate(-50%)rotate(-40deg)translateY(-200px)rotate(40deg)}@media not (min-width:768px){.Hero-module-scss-module__wWWu7W__icon_pos_1{transform:translate(-50%)rotate(-40deg)translateY(-270px)rotate(40deg)}}.Hero-module-scss-module__wWWu7W__icon_pos_2{transform:translate(-50%)rotate(-70deg)translateY(-400px)rotate(70deg)}@media not (min-width:768px){.Hero-module-scss-module__wWWu7W__icon_pos_2{transform:translate(0%)rotate(-70deg)translateY(-320px)rotate(70deg)}}.Hero-module-scss-module__wWWu7W__icon_pos_3{transform:translate(-50%)rotate(25deg)translateY(-400px)rotate(-25deg)}.Hero-module-scss-module__wWWu7W__icon_pos_4{transform:translate(-50%)rotate(-30deg)translateY(-600px)rotate(30deg)}@media not (min-width:768px){.Hero-module-scss-module__wWWu7W__icon_pos_4{transform:translate(0%)rotate(-30deg)translateY(-420px)rotate(30deg)}}.Hero-module-scss-module__wWWu7W__icon_pos_5{transform:translate(-50%)rotate(55deg)translateY(-600px)rotate(-55deg)}@media not (min-width:768px){.Hero-module-scss-module__wWWu7W__icon_pos_5{transform:translate(-10%)rotate(55deg)translateY(-100px)rotate(-55deg)}}.Hero-module-scss-module__wWWu7W__icon_pos_6{transform:translate(-50%)rotate(-75deg)translateY(-600px)rotate(75deg)}@media not (min-width:768px){.Hero-module-scss-module__wWWu7W__icon_pos_6{transform:translate(-50%)rotate(-75deg)translateY(-200px)rotate(75deg)}}.Hero-module-scss-module__wWWu7W__delay_1{animation-delay:1.11s}.Hero-module-scss-module__wWWu7W__delay_2{animation-delay:.44s}.Hero-module-scss-module__wWWu7W__delay_3{animation-delay:2.55s}.Hero-module-scss-module__wWWu7W__delay_4{animation-delay:1.33s}.Hero-module-scss-module__wWWu7W__delay_5{animation-delay:3.22s}.Hero-module-scss-module__wWWu7W__delay_6{animation-delay:.33s}@keyframes Hero-module-scss-module__wWWu7W__sweep{0%{transform:translate(-50%)rotate(-90deg)}to{transform:translate(-50%)rotate(270deg)}}@keyframes Hero-module-scss-module__wWWu7W__radar_ping{0%{border-color:var(--gold,#fcc11b);box-shadow:0 0 20px color-mix(in srgb, var(--gold,#fcc11b) 50%, transparent),inset 0 0 15px color-mix(in srgb, var(--gold,#fcc11b) 10%, transparent);background-color:color-mix(in srgb, var(--gold,#fcc11b) 10%, transparent)}20%{border-color:var(--border);box-shadow:0 10px 25px color-mix(in srgb, var(--foreground) 10%, transparent);background-color:color-mix(in srgb, var(--card) 60%, transparent)}to{border-color:var(--border);box-shadow:0 10px 25px color-mix(in srgb, var(--foreground) 10%, transparent);background-color:color-mix(in srgb, var(--card) 60%, transparent)}}@media (max-width:1024px){.Hero-module-scss-module__wWWu7W__radar_wrapper{width:1000px;height:500px}}
